Breaking Down the Features of Parter Medical Petri Dishes, Sterile 3571 Gamma Radiation Sterilized Stackable For Automation, Case of 600
Specifications
- Description: Stackable for Automation. This design facilitates robotic handling in high-throughput environments, a critical factor for larger studies.
- Dia. x H, mm: 100 x 15. The standard 100mm diameter provides ample surface area for culturing, while the 15mm height allows for sufficient media depth without being overly bulky.
- Quantity per Bag: 24. Packaging in bags of 24 helps maintain sterility while minimizing waste.
- Unit: Case of 600. A case of 600 provides a substantial supply for extensive projects, reducing the frequency of reordering.

Pros and Cons of Parter Medical Petri Dishes, Sterile 3571 Gamma Radiation Sterilized Stackable For Automation, Case of 600
Pros
- Reliable Sterility: Gamma radiation sterilization assures a high level of sterility, minimizing the risk of contamination.
- Stackable Design: The stackable design, optimized for automation, saves valuable lab space and streamlines handling.
- Optical Clarity: Virgin polystyrene provides distortion-free visibility for easy reading and microscopic examination.
- Consistent Flatness: Engineered for optimum flatness to provide uniform agar thickness.
- Venting Ribs: Venting ribs on inside cover allow free circulation of air and prevent condensation buildup.
Cons
- Lid Seal: While secure, the lid seal could be slightly tighter for improved containment in high-pressure environments.
- Price: At $819.99 per case, the cost may be prohibitive for smaller labs with limited budgets.
